GameShark Codes ======================================================================= Chapter I: Modes and Basic Gameplay ======================================================================= Circuit: In this mode you fight against the computer in tournaments to gain credits and treasure items, so you may try to become the overall strongest fighter in the circuit. To get to the championship tournament to defeat a platinum character, you must first win a sub tournament, its kind of like a qualifying round. If you lose, well I have never lost, but when I do I will let you know. Tournament Mode: Can play with up to eight players, human or CPU controlled. You can play with the full 4 player deck for ultimate rumbles. Beware, I have had tournaments delete my game data, but it should warn you before you do it. Practice: This is just a place to hold practice fights and get more experience. This is where you should memorize those moves and strategies. It is also a good way to scout all of your opponents without really losing a fight doing it. Vs Mode: Holds up to 2 human players. This is like the MK versus mode. Basically you both choose a character, and then do battle where ever the CPU puts you. Usually its in P1's home arena. Treasure Items: This is a place where you can check yours or all of the other players items. You can also trade with other players, and go to the store and buy items from the lady if you have nay credits. Options: Here you can set basic things like Sound, difficulty and that sort of thing. You can mess around with it and get it how you want it. Group Battle: Here each player(Human) will choose 5 fighters to be on there team. When a fighter loses they are gone. Whoever has the most fighters at the end of the battle when, which has to be atleast one. Ryumaou Tournament: Yep, this is the big one, the mother of all tournaments. So here's how it go's down. You have to compete in the Championship tournaments, and each time you beat a platinum character, you get a medal. Well when you get up around six medals ( that when I got invited ) you will be confronted by Ryumaou a giant warrior. In the tournament you will face 8 warriors, all of them are platinum characters so beware. Then at the end, in the final match you will face Ryumaou. He is very string so be careful. After you defeat him, you will receive your treasure, and then you will be able to select him as a characters in Circuit mode. To find him you have to scroll through all of the characters until he appears. ======================================================================= Chapter II: Training Mode ======================================================================= Training Modes Free Training - Here you can work on anything. Such as moves, combos or just getting used to the controls. Your opponent is more of a crash dummy, they don't fight back. Minds Eye - This is a test of your reflexes. If you can pass this test you will easily defend against fast opponents. This is one is good for practice, but it can get pretty hard. Practice Match - Practice in a scrimmage fight againt any of the normally selectable characters. This is good to develop strategies against certain players that you can't beat. Command List - This is a list of all of your characters moves. Sometimes this list is in a different language- ( Japanese ). Command Training - The screen will show a move, once you have completed it you will move on to the next. The moves get harder to do every time you pass to the next level. SPEED TRAINING -------------- O-O When training to gain speed there are two ways. One, you might just have a god given talent, which is rather unlikely. The other way is train constantly in the training mode. But you can't just train any type of exercise, so here are some thing you can do to enhance you speed, and this will also increase your hand eye coordination. Exercise 1 ---------- When training as an adult fighter in the Hiryu mode, have the options set on 3D, and go to a practice game. Pressing the Z button on your controller will make you switch your D line. Practice waiting until your opponent is just about to hit you than move out of the way with the Z button, getting out of the way just before he hits you. Try doing this against Gengai, as he is one of the faster players in that mode. When you can dodge this 9/10 times, you will have passed the ancient art of dodging. Exercise 2 ---------- This one is a little more basic than the other method of gaining speed, and it is also a little more of a trick than a manuever. When your opponent is down, jump over him. Switching to the side that you didn't attack from. Now, you have to do the next part extremely fast, and you have to time it right. 2 seconds before he is about get up throw whatever your shooting move is at him/her. If you time this correctly it will hit him just as he is turning around, before he has a chance to mount a block. This should actually be called false speed. MOVE TRAINING ------------- O-O There are lots of ways to become faster at moves. This is a key element to any fighter, because even if your stronger, butt he is faster, it isn't gonn matter. So there are a couple thing you can do to help this. One , is memorize your moves. I would recommend that you choose a player, and then just always use him/her whenever possible. Exercise 1 ---------- Take the move list for your character off of this faq, and memorize all of there moves. Then once you know them all, go to training and put it on free training. If you can do all of the moves in no more than two tries a piece, it is really gonna help the odd's of you winning a fight. After you have done that, come up with a plan as to what moves and how many you will need to defeat your enemy. Exercise 2 ---------- Scout all of your enemies so that you will know all of there weak points, not to mention the strong ones. This way you will be able to use you speed to your advantage, if you completed my speed exercises that is. Level 0- Everyone! 91- Kung Fu Jacket Def +1 Level 0- Everyone. 92- Nameless Fang ATRO 80% Attack -2 Throw -2 Level 0- Everyone. ======================================================================= Chapter VI: Cheats and Secrets ======================================================================= Play as Ryumaou: Beat the Ryumaou Tournament. Play as Bokchin: Beat Bokuchin in the normal game. Easier Game: Highlight the difficulty level and put it on easy, then press left 20 times, it should switch to very easy. Harder Game: Do the same as you did for the easier game except in reverse. Platinum Character: Get all ten medals from the Hiryu Circuit. ======================================================================= Chapter VII: GameShark Codes ======================================================================= These codes work with Gameshark models 2.0 and higher.
